The British pound rose to its highest level in six months against the dollar, reaching 1.3661 USD after the U.S. government announced it would double its purchases of long-term bonds, leading to a sharp decline in 30-year bond yields. This increase occurred despite domestic factors such as rising inflation and a sluggish UK labor market, while analysts expect the Bank of England to keep interest rates unchanged in the coming period.
